ST. CLOUD, Minn. – Freshman
Sam Frazee (Cook, Minn./North Woods) shot 5-over-par 77 to lead the UW-Superior men's golf team in the opening round of the SJU Fall Invitational at St. Cloud Country Club on Saturday.
The Yellowjackets carded 28-over 316 to tie for ninth overall on the 6,676-yard, par-72 course. Frazee's season-low round featured a birdie on the par-4 fifth hole to go with 12 pars. He is tied for 25th overall going into Sunday's final round.
Sophomore
Cody Stanisich (Eveleth, Minn./Eveleth-Gilbert Senior), the reigning UMAC Player of the Week, is one stroke behind Frazee after a 78 in a tie for 27th. Stanisich birdied the par-4 14th and shot par on 11 holes.
Freshman
Taylor Burger (Superior, Wis./Superior Senior) shot 8-over 80 with four birdies and four pars. He was tripped up, though, with double bogeys on both 17 and 18, and is tied for 36th.
Senior
Sam Albrecht (Gilbert, Minn./Eveleth-Gilbert Senior) shot 81 to tie for 38th overall. He birdied the fourth hole and collected 10 pars in his round.
Freshman
Ian Bundy (Austin, Minn./Austin) shot 85 and sits tied for 54th.
Tournament-host Saint John's fired a 3-under 285 to hold the team lead by six strokes over second-place Bethel. Carleton (12-over-par 300) is third. Casey Parker of St. Olaf and the Johnnies' Nate Loxtercamp are tied the individual lead at 4-under 68.
The tournament concludes at Blackberry Ridge Golf Club in Sartell, Minn., on Sunday. The Yellowjackets tee off beginning at 9:50 a.m.
